How This Service Actually Works

Commercial water extraction isn’t just about removing water. It’s about stopping the damage before it spreads. A rushed or incomplete job can lead to mold, structural issues, and costly repairs. You need a team that follows the right steps and uses the right tools. Our process is designed to handle every detail, from the first call to the final inspection.

Assessment and Planning

Your property is unique and so is the water damage. We start by evaluating the extent of the problem. We look for hidden moisture and identify the source. This step is critical to making sure no detail is missed. Accurate assessment leads to targeted solutions. Thorough planning sets the stage for a successful recovery.

Water Removal

We use high-powered extractors to remove standing water quickly. The goal is to get the water out before it soaks into floors and walls. This step is time-sensitive and critical to preventing further damage. We work efficiently but carefully to avoid causing more issues. Fast extraction is the first step in effective recovery.

Dehumidification and Drying

Once the water is gone, we move to drying. We use industrial dehumidifiers and air movers to remove moisture from the air and surfaces. This step can take 3-5 days depending on the size of the area. Proper drying stops mold and keeps your property safe. Consistent monitoring ensures we meet drying goals. Reliable equipment makes this part of the process efficient and effective.

Sanitization and Disinfection

Water can bring in bacteria and contaminants. We clean and disinfect all affected areas to make your space safe. This includes floors, walls, and any materials that came into contact with the water. Warning Signs You Need Commercial Water Extraction

Water damage can be sneaky. You might not see the problem at first, but it can grow quickly. Catching it early is the best way to avoid bigger issues. You need to act when you spot these signs. Early intervention makes all the difference in the outcome.

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

A damp smell in your building is a red flag. It can mean moisture is trapped in walls or under floors. This is a sign of hidden water that needs to be addressed. Early detection stops mold. Quick response prevents bad smells. Professional help is the best way to fix this.

Water Stains on Ceilings or Walls

Stains that look like they came from water are a clear sign of damage. They can show where leaks have been or where water has pooled. This is a warning that more damage could follow. Visible signs mean action is needed. Timely intervention keeps the problem from growing. Expert assessment is key to fixing this.

Warping or Buckling Floors

Wood or tile floors that are warped or buckled are a sign of moisture underneath. This can lead to structural issues if not handled. You don’t want to ignore this. Structural damage is costly to fix. Early action saves money. Professional extraction is the best way to handle this.

High Humidity Levels

If the air feels damp or sticky, it could mean moisture is lingering. This is common after a water event. You need to address it before mold grows. Moisture control is important. Proper drying stops mold. Expert monitoring ensures the job is done right.

Water Under Carpets or Flooring

Standing water under your carpet or flooring is a serious problem. It can lead to mold and damage to the structure. You need to act fast. Hidden water is dangerous. Quick removal is essential. Professional extraction is the safest way to handle this.

Unusual Puddles or Damp Spots

Even small puddles or damp spots can mean a bigger issue. They can show where water is pooling or leaking. You don’t want to ignore this. Small signs can mean big problems. Early detection is the best defense. Professional help is the way to go.

Commercial Water Extraction v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small puddle on the floor Yes No It’s better to call a pro if the water is more than 2 inches deep.
Water under a carpet No Yes Professional extraction is needed to avoid mold and damage.
Leak from a pipe or appliance No Yes Fixing the source is critical and needs specialized tools.
Water in a commercial kitchen No Yes Health codes and safety standards need professional handling.
Water from a flood No Yes Large volumes of water need immediate and expert attention.
Water in a sealed room No Yes Moisture can be trapped and cause long-term issues.

Commercial Water Extraction Cost In Richland Hills, TX

Costs vary depending on the severity of the damage. You need to know what to expect. We give you realistic estimates based on the work required. These are not guarantees but a good starting point. Clear pricing helps you plan. Transparent estimates build trust. Realistic expectations make the process easier.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water Removal $500 – $2,500 Amount of water and size of area.
Dehumidification $300 – $1,500 Time needed for drying and equipment used.
Sanitization $200 – $1,000 Extent of contamination and materials affected.
Structural Drying $500 – $3,000 Size of space and moisture levels.
Restoration $1,000 – $5,000+ Type of materials and damage level.
Emergency Response $200 – $1,000 Urgency and availability of technicians.
